About Tomokazu Fuji

Tomokazu Fuji is a scholar working on Oncology, Hepatology and Transplantation, having authored 58 papers that have together received 323 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(30 papers), Gallbladder and Bile Duct Disorders (11 papers) and Cholangiocarcinoma and Gallbladder Cancer Studies (10 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hepatology (86 citations), Transplantation (20 citations) and Nephrology (40 citations). Tomokazu Fuji has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Toshiyoshi Fujiwara, Yuzo Umeda, Ryuichi Yoshida, Takahito Yagi, Kosei Takagi, Takeshi Nagasaka, Susumu Shinoura, Daisuke Nobuoka, Masashi Utsumi and Ajay Goel.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and Cancer Research.
